Dr Barnwell’s opioid policy.

Dr Barnwell only accepts patients who want to control their pain without opioids (narcotics) or who want help in reducing and stopping their current opioids usage. She will accept patients who are currently taking opioids but are committed to decreasing their use of opioids. She has chosen this style of practice because she has learned from 30 years of experience that opioids make it harder to control chronic pain.

Other important information about Dr. Barnwell’s opioid policy:

Instead of using just medications and procedures to dull the sensation of pain, Dr Barnwell takes the time to do a very thorough history and examination of your problem to find the cause of your pain and then educate you on how to manage the cause. This approach takes more time by Dr Barnwell and more patience and diligence on your part but can result in management of your pain without the side effects, costs and risks of medications and procedures. She may temporarily use medications and procedures but only to the extent that will support you in learning how to manage your pain. .

Drug detection tests are performed before providing prescriptions for DEA controlled medications and periodically at the sole discretion of Dr Barnwell. All drug tests will be at your expense for any amount not covered by your insurance. Please be very careful to tell Dr Barnwell ALL the controlled medications that you are taking before the test. If you are not sure if a medication is controlled, ASK.

  Opioids will temporarily be prescribed if necessary only if you are following her recommendations and only if you are showing objective improvement in your pain control.
